Why Smart Buyers and Investors Choose Professional Rebar Fabricators
For procurement managers, project owners, and investors, steel reinforcement is not just a construction material—it is a major cost driver that directly affects cash flow, project risk, and return on investment. Choosing a professional rebar fabricator instead of relying on on-site cutting and bending is a strategic decision that delivers measurable financial and operational benefits.
Predictable costs and better budget control
One of the biggest challenges for buyers is cost uncertainty. On-site rebar processing often leads to over-ordering, waste, and uncontrolled labor expenses. Professional rebar fabricators work from approved drawings and bar bending schedules, providing accurate quantity take-offs before production begins. This allows procurement teams to lock in volumes, control material usage, and avoid hidden costs caused by rework and excess scrap.
Faster project delivery means higher capital efficiency
From an investment perspective, time is money. Delays in structural work slow down the entire construction cycle and postpone revenue generation. With off-site cut-and-bend rebar processing, fabrication can run in parallel with site preparation. Reinforcement arrives ready for installation, reducing idle time and accelerating critical milestones such as foundation and slab completion. Faster delivery improves capital turnover and reduces financing pressure.
Reduced operational and safety risks
Professional rebar fabrication shifts high-risk activities—cutting, bending, and handling—from the construction site to a controlled factory environment. This reduces on-site safety incidents, labor dependency, and weather-related disruptions. For investors and project owners, fewer site risks mean fewer claims, fewer stoppages, and more stable project execution.
Consistent quality and compliance across projects
Quality issues in reinforcement directly translate into structural risk and long-term liability. Rebar fabricators operate under standardized processing procedures and international material standards such as ASTM, BS, or GB. Traceable bundles, clear labeling, and documented shop drawings make inspection and approval more efficient. For buyers managing multiple projects or international portfolios, this consistency is essential.
Supply chain reliability and logistics efficiency
A qualified rebar fabricator acts as a supply chain partner rather than just a material vendor. Sequenced delivery, bundled by installation area, reduces site congestion and storage costs. Reliable lead times and export experience are especially important for overseas projects where delays can be extremely costly.
